Hey guys! Ever feel like managing IT projects is like herding cats? Between developers, testers, project managers, and stakeholders, keeping everyone on the same page can feel impossible. That's where Jira comes in – it's the ultimate project management tool designed to wrangle those cats and bring order to your chaos. In this comprehensive guide, we'll dive deep into Jira for IT project management, exploring its features, benefits, and how to use it effectively. Whether you're a seasoned project manager or just starting out, this is your one-stop shop for mastering Jira and streamlining your IT projects. Jira isn't just a tool; it's a game-changer for IT teams. It offers a centralized platform for managing all aspects of a project, from issue tracking and bug fixing to sprint planning and release management. With Jira, you can say goodbye to endless email chains, confusing spreadsheets, and missed deadlines. Instead, you'll have a clear view of your project's progress, the ability to collaborate seamlessly, and the power to make data-driven decisions. So, let's get started and uncover the secrets of using Jira to achieve IT project success. This guide will walk you through setting up Jira, customizing it for your specific needs, and leveraging its powerful features to optimize your workflow. From beginners to experts, we'll have something for everyone. So, buckle up, because we're about to transform how you manage your IT projects!

    What is Jira and Why Use It for IT Projects?

    Alright, so what exactly is Jira, and why is it the go-to choice for so many IT teams? Simply put, Jira is a project management and issue tracking software developed by Atlassian. It's designed to help teams plan, track, and manage their work effectively. While it's particularly popular in the software development world, Jira is versatile enough to be used across a wide range of IT projects, from infrastructure upgrades to cybersecurity implementations. Now, you might be wondering, why not just use a simple spreadsheet or a shared document? Well, here's the deal: Jira offers a level of functionality and integration that those basic tools just can't match. Jira goes far beyond simple task lists; it provides a complete ecosystem for managing the entire project lifecycle. It's built to support agile methodologies, offering features like scrum boards and kanban boards, and integrates seamlessly with other development tools. This makes it an ideal choice for software development teams who are looking to work efficiently. From issue tracking and bug reporting to sprint planning and release management, Jira has got you covered. This is the main reason why many IT professionals lean on it. Jira keeps everything organized in one central location, so you can track progress, manage resources, and communicate with your team more effectively. It gives you real-time insights into your project's status, helping you to identify potential roadblocks and keep your projects on track. Plus, Jira can be customized to fit your specific needs, so you can adapt it to match your team's unique workflow and processes. The benefits don't stop there. Jira also promotes collaboration, transparency, and accountability, creating a more productive and efficient work environment. By using Jira, you can improve communication, reduce errors, and ultimately deliver projects on time and within budget. This is why Jira has become the go-to tool for IT project management. This also includes many aspects like project planning, bug tracking, workflow automation, and reporting & analytics.

    Key Features of Jira for IT Project Management

    Let's get down to the nitty-gritty and explore some of the key features that make Jira such a powerful tool for IT project management. Jira is packed with functionalities designed to streamline your workflow and boost your team's productivity. Understanding these features is the key to harnessing Jira's full potential. Ready to dive in? Here are some of the most important features:

    • Issue Tracking: At the heart of Jira lies its issue tracking capability. You can create, assign, and track issues, bugs, and tasks within your project. Each issue can be detailed with descriptions, attachments, and comments. This feature allows you to keep track of everything, from minor tasks to critical bugs, ensuring that nothing falls through the cracks. It also provides a clear audit trail of all changes and updates, which improves transparency and accountability. With Jira's issue tracking, it's easy to see the status of each issue at a glance. You can filter and sort issues based on various criteria, such as priority, assignee, or status. The feature is the foundation of effective IT project management.
    • Workflow Customization: Jira allows you to customize workflows to match your team's processes. You can create and define stages (e.g., To Do, In Progress, Done) and transitions between them. This is very essential, because it allows you to create workflows that reflect your specific needs. You can design workflows that match your existing processes or build new ones from scratch. This flexibility ensures that Jira works for you, not the other way around. Workflow customization is particularly useful for IT projects, which often involve complex, multi-stage processes. With Jira, you can ensure that each task moves through the correct stages, with all required steps completed. This feature helps to reduce errors, improve efficiency, and make sure that everyone is on the same page.
    • Agile Project Management Tools (Scrum and Kanban Boards): Jira fully embraces agile methodologies. It offers built-in support for Scrum and Kanban boards, which are essential for agile project management. Scrum boards allow you to plan sprints, track progress, and manage the backlog. Kanban boards visualize your workflow, helping you to identify bottlenecks and optimize the flow of work. Both boards are very helpful in planning and keeping track of the agile methodology. These tools provide a visual representation of your project, making it easier to see what tasks are in progress, what needs to be done, and who is responsible for each task. With Jira, you can easily switch between Scrum and Kanban boards, depending on your team's needs. This flexibility makes Jira an ideal choice for IT teams that are using agile. These features increase flexibility and collaboration.
    • Reporting and Analytics: Jira offers a robust set of reporting and analytics tools that give you valuable insights into your project's progress. You can generate reports on a variety of metrics, such as cycle time, lead time, and velocity. These reports allow you to track your team's performance, identify areas for improvement, and make data-driven decisions. Jira's reporting capabilities are extremely helpful for IT project managers. You can use these insights to monitor progress, identify trends, and make sure that projects are delivered on time and within budget. By using these reports, you can improve project outcomes and communicate the project's status effectively.
    • Integrations: Jira seamlessly integrates with a wide variety of other tools that you probably use every day. These include code repositories (like GitHub and Bitbucket), collaboration tools (like Slack), and other development tools. These integrations make it easy to bring all your work into a single platform. For IT teams, this is a major benefit, as it reduces the need to switch between multiple tools and platforms. With Jira, you can access all the information you need in one place, so you can focus on the job. Jira's integrations save time, reduce errors, and improve team productivity. This makes it a central hub for all project-related activities.

    Setting Up Jira for Your IT Project

    Alright, you're sold on Jira, and now it's time to get down to brass tacks: setting it up for your IT project. Don't worry, it's not as daunting as it sounds! Let's break down the process step by step, ensuring you have a smooth setup experience. You'll be ready to manage your IT projects like a pro. From initial setup to customizing your project settings, here's what you need to know:

    • Choose Your Jira Plan: First things first, you'll need to choose a Jira plan that fits your team's needs. Atlassian offers several plans, including free, standard, premium, and enterprise options. The free plan is great for small teams and allows you to test out Jira's basic features. The paid plans offer more storage, advanced features, and support options. Think about your team size, project complexity, and any specific features you'll need. Decide what works for your situation. Choosing the right plan is key to setting up your Jira instance.
    • Create a Jira Account and Project: Once you've chosen your plan, go ahead and create your Atlassian account. After signing in, you can then start setting up your first project. Jira will guide you through the process, prompting you to choose a project type (e.g., software development, project management). Now, give your project a name and set a key. The key is a short code that will be used to identify issues within your project. Following these easy steps will create your project in Jira.
    • Configure Project Settings: After you've created your project, take some time to configure your project settings. This is where you can tailor Jira to your specific project needs. Set your project lead, add team members, define issue types (e.g., bug, task, story), and set up your project's workflow. This is also where you can customize your notifications. Spend some time customizing the settings. Configuring these settings is very essential for a well-organized project.
    • Customize Workflows: As mentioned earlier, Jira's workflow customization is very powerful. When setting up your project, spend some time defining workflows that match your team's processes. You can create different workflows for different issue types. With Jira, you can create the stages and transitions that match your project's processes. Making workflows customized can improve efficiency and reduce errors.
    • Integrate with Other Tools: Jira integrates seamlessly with many other tools, so take advantage of these integrations to streamline your workflow. Connect Jira with your code repository (e.g., GitHub, Bitbucket), collaboration tools (e.g., Slack), and any other tools that your team uses. By integrating with other tools, you can ensure that all the information your team needs is in one central location.

    Customizing Jira for Your IT Project

    Alright, you've got Jira up and running, but now it's time to make it your own. Customizing Jira is the secret sauce that makes it truly valuable for your IT project. You can tailor it to match your team's specific needs, workflow, and processes. It's like a tailored suit. You have the flexibility to adjust Jira to maximize efficiency and project success. Let's explore how you can customize Jira to suit your project.

    • Customize Issue Types: Jira comes with default issue types like Bug, Task, and Story. You can add new issue types or customize the existing ones to match your project's specific needs. For example, you might add a